Key questions
How can I become a painter and decorator?
To become a painter and decorator in Busselton, you may want to consider completing the Certificate III in Painting and Decorating. This qualification will equip you with the skills and knowledge necessary for a career in this industry.
Are there training providers in Busselton?
You can train to become a painter and decorator by completing a qualification with Australian Industrial Systems Institute or Canberra Business and Technology College.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the painter and decorator sector.
Signwriter
A Signwriter designs and installs signs for businesses and public spaces, using digital software and various materials to meet client needs.
Sign Installer
A Sign Installer erects various types of signs in public and commercial spaces, requiring precision in measurements and strong customer service skills.
Vehicle Wrapper
A Vehicle Wrapper designs and applies advertising graphics to vehicles, collaborating with clients to create suitable decals and ensuring precise application.
